Measurement in Δ Networks with a Grounded Line Conductor
For measurement in 3-phase networks with a grounded line conductor, the
I/O module offers the 2-wattmeter method (Aron circuit/Blondel's Theorem)
connection option.

7.7.1.2.1 2-Wattmeter Method (Aron Circuit/Blondel's Theorem)

For voltage measurement, set the topology to "3-Wire Wye/Delta" ("3-W") in
WAGO-I/O-Check.
This topology is available with firmware versions 05 and above and WAGO-
I/O-Check versions IO-3.18.1 (CS0609) and above.
This measurement circuit is used in all 3-phase networks without a neutral
conductor with a grounded line conductor and with loads in a wye or delta
connection.
The measurement circuit uses the principle of the 2-wattmeter method.

The current measurement is performed via current transformers (CTs).
The current transformer ratio must be taken into account for the correct
calculation of all values in the process image.
